本文目录导读:
在信息爆炸的时代,如何高效、准确地存储、管理和查询数据,成为了一个亟待解决的问题,关系数据库作为一种成熟、稳定的数据存储方式,凭借其独特的优势,成为现代企业、政府机构和个人用户的首选,关系数据库的数据模型究竟是什么模型?它又是如何构成的?本文将为您深入解析。
关系数据库数据模型概述
关系数据库数据模型,又称关系模型,是数据库管理系统中的一种数据组织方式,它以二维表格的形式组织数据,每个表格称为一个关系,表格中的行称为元组,列称为属性,关系模型的核心思想是“关系”,即通过建立实体与实体之间的联系,实现数据的关联和查询。
关系数据库数据模型的组成
1、关系
关系是关系数据库数据模型的基本单位,它由属性集和元组集组成,在关系模型中,每个关系都对应一个二维表格,表格中的每一行代表一个元组,每一列代表一个属性。
图片来源于网络,如有侵权联系删除
(1)属性:属性是关系的组成部分,用于描述实体的某个特征,在学生关系表中,姓名、性别、年龄等都是属性。
(2)元组:元组是关系中的一个具体实例,代表一个实体,在学生关系表中,每个学生信息构成一个元组。
2、关系模式
关系模式是关系的结构定义,包括关系的名称、属性名和属性的类型,关系模式是关系数据库设计的基础,它描述了关系中的数据结构和约束条件。
3、关系约束
关系约束是关系数据库数据模型中的规则,用于限制关系的属性值,常见的约束条件有:
(1)主键约束:确保每个关系中的元组具有唯一标识符。
图片来源于网络,如有侵权联系删除
(2)外键约束:确保关系之间的引用完整性。
(3)唯一性约束:确保某个属性的值在关系中的唯一性。
(4)非空约束:确保某个属性的值不为空。
4、关系操作
关系操作是关系数据库数据模型中的基本操作,包括查询、插入、删除和更新,这些操作可以应用于关系,实现对数据的增删改查。
关系数据库数据模型的特点
1、灵活性:关系模型可以灵活地表示各种数据结构,适应不同应用场景。
2、易于理解:关系模型以二维表格的形式组织数据,易于用户理解和使用。
图片来源于网络,如有侵权联系删除
3、强大:关系模型提供了丰富的查询语言(如SQL),支持复杂的查询操作。
4、可扩展性:关系模型可以方便地扩展,适应数据量的增长。
5、数据完整性:关系模型提供了丰富的约束条件,确保数据的完整性。
关系数据库数据模型作为一种成熟、稳定的数据存储方式,以其独特的优势在信息世界中发挥着重要作用,通过对关系数据库数据模型的深入理解,我们可以更好地设计、管理和使用数据库,为信息时代的到来奠定坚实基础。
标签: #关系数据库的数据模型是什么模型
评论列表